Core Insights - Jiangsu province has been at the forefront of promoting intelligent manufacturing and digital transformation since December 2021, with a three-year action plan initiated to enhance these efforts [1][2] - The province aims to further amplify the effects of intelligent transformation and digitalization through a new three-year action plan focusing on network connectivity, set to be implemented by December 2024 [1][2] Group 1: Implementation and Achievements - As of now, over 56,000 digital transformation projects have been implemented in Jiangsu, achieving a CNC (Computer Numerical Control) rate of 70.1% for key processes in major enterprises and a digital management penetration rate of 89.1%, surpassing the "14th Five-Year Plan" targets [2] - Jiangsu has created 14 national digital leading enterprises and 68 excellent intelligent factories, with 15 enterprises recognized as global "lighthouse factories," the highest number in the country [2] - The province has maintained the top position in the integration of informatization and industrialization for ten consecutive years and has led in the high-quality development index of manufacturing for four years [2] Group 2: Future Plans - The next phase involves implementing a new round of the "Intelligent Transformation, Digital Transformation, and Network Connectivity" three-year action plan, with quantifiable goals set [2] - The plan includes guiding over 10,000 large-scale industrial enterprises annually to establish basic intelligent factories, with more than 2,000 advancing to advanced intelligent factories and over 1,000 achieving excellence [2] - Additionally, approximately 10,000 innovative small and medium-sized enterprises, 3,000 specialized and innovative SMEs, and 1,000 "little giant" enterprises will be supported in their digital transformation efforts [2]
